Community Service Associates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 219,637 | 221,468 | −1,831 | 7.1 | 59% |
| 2012 | 184,578 | 221,359 | −36,781 | 5.1 | 59% |
| 2013 | 242,919 | 225,028 | 17,891 | 5.9 | 58% |
| 2014 | 191,493 | 214,851 | −23,358 | 4.9 | 61% |
| 2015 | 235,889 | 211,342 | 24,547 | 0.0 | 64% |
| 2016 | 153,335 | 196,365 | −43,030 | 4.3 | 43% |
| 2017 | 128,795 | 185,110 | −56,315 | 0.9 | 45% |
| 2018 | 100,000 | 0 | 100,000 | — | — |
| 2019 | 228,254 | 189,120 | 39,134 | 3.2 | 72% |
| 2020 | 133,755 | 135,358 | −1,603 | 4.4 | 66% |
| 2021 | 195,310 | 170,701 | 24,609 | 5.2 | 81% |
| 2022 | 156,260 | 199,298 | −43,038 | 0.0 | 69% |
| 2023 | 207,356 | 206,598 | 758 | 1.3 | 69%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$758 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 1.3 months of spending, down from 7.1 in 2011. Staff pay was 69%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023. Years refer to the calendar year in which the organization's fiscal year ended. Short-form filers do not publicly report donor-restricted balances or staffing costs. Source filings
